Size: a a a

2020 August 23

VA

Vadim Apenko in aiogram [ru]
Alexander
Почему? Как лучше тогда?
Надо понять, зачем вооьще конфиги нужны и в чем смысл их хранить.
Чем отличается хранение в коде от отдельного файла с конфигами, например yaml. Зачем некоторые конфиги хранятся в переменных среды.  


Так вот, для себя я сделал такое правило, конфиги хранятся в {env_name}.yaml
Их как минимум три.
local.yaml
tests.yaml
prod.yaml

Везде прописаны пути к базам, мокам и прочее.

Токены и секретные данные только в переменных среды.
источник

A

Alexander in aiogram [ru]
Alexander
А докер для чего нужен? Я примерно понимаю, что это для быстрого развертывания приложения со всеми установленными дополнениями, но нужен ли он мне для бота?
Как я понимаю, с помощью докера смогу автоматически перезапускать бота, как только он упадет?\
источник

VA

Vadim Apenko in aiogram [ru]
Alexander
Как я понимаю, с помощью докера смогу автоматически перезапускать бота, как только он упадет?\
Да.
источник

A

Alexander in aiogram [ru]
источник

$

$name$ in aiogram [ru]
Vadim Apenko
Надо понять, зачем вооьще конфиги нужны и в чем смысл их хранить.
Чем отличается хранение в коде от отдельного файла с конфигами, например yaml. Зачем некоторые конфиги хранятся в переменных среды.  


Так вот, для себя я сделал такое правило, конфиги хранятся в {env_name}.yaml
Их как минимум три.
local.yaml
tests.yaml
prod.yaml

Везде прописаны пути к базам, мокам и прочее.

Токены и секретные данные только в переменных среды.
Как сложно
источник

A

Alexander in aiogram [ru]
Такой вопрос, что мне нужно?)
источник

VA

Vadim Apenko in aiogram [ru]
$name$
Как сложно
Ну если говнокодишь что-то время жизни которого 1 месяц - то насрать где конфиги хранить
источник

𝕾

𝕾𝖔𝖚𝕷𝕭𝖆𝕯𝕲𝖚𝖄... in aiogram [ru]
Ребят, всем привет, такой вопрос. Как в инлайн кнопках запретить нажатие более одного раза по паре кнопок?
Конкретный пример:
Есть сообщение с информацией, под ним 5 инлайн кнопок, например.
2 из них отвечают за голосование - палец вверх и вниз (обе со счетчиком). Мне нужно, чтобы когда пользователь нажимал на одну из этих двух кнопок, он не мог нажать второй раз как по этой кнопке, так и по второй. При этом 3 остальные работали, тк они за голосование не отвечают.
Реально такое сделать?
источник

f

fishsouprecipe 🤍 in aiogram [ru]
Evgen Fil // 🎲
А data используется для кваргов хендлера
А для апдейт есть такое?
источник

V

Vela in aiogram [ru]
𝕾𝖔𝖚𝕷𝕭𝖆𝕯𝕲𝖚𝖄
Ребят, всем привет, такой вопрос. Как в инлайн кнопках запретить нажатие более одного раза по паре кнопок?
Конкретный пример:
Есть сообщение с информацией, под ним 5 инлайн кнопок, например.
2 из них отвечают за голосование - палец вверх и вниз (обе со счетчиком). Мне нужно, чтобы когда пользователь нажимал на одну из этих двух кнопок, он не мог нажать второй раз как по этой кнопке, так и по второй. При этом 3 остальные работали, тк они за голосование не отвечают.
Реально такое сделать?
По идеи, записывать всех проголосовавших, но мб профи тут подскажут не такой гкод вариант)
источник

ЕП

Евгений Петров... in aiogram [ru]
Alexander
Как я понимаю, с помощью докера смогу автоматически перезапускать бота, как только он упадет?\
Да и без докера это можно, systemd во многих дистрах уже есть
источник

$

$name$ in aiogram [ru]
Евгений Петров
Да и без докера это можно, systemd во многих дистрах уже есть
Привет винда 😂
источник

A

Alexander in aiogram [ru]
Евгений Петров
Да и без докера это можно, systemd во многих дистрах уже есть
Первый раз использую Python, первый раз пишу бота
источник

A

Alexander in aiogram [ru]
Есть смысл попробовать докер?
источник

A

Alexander in aiogram [ru]
Хочу сделать заказ максимально качественно, чтобы меня рекомендовали в дальнейшем)
источник

V

Vela in aiogram [ru]
Даже заказ
источник

V

Vela in aiogram [ru]
Первый раз
источник

ЕП

Евгений Петров... in aiogram [ru]
Alexander
Есть смысл попробовать докер?
Смысл пробовать есть всегда, но может лучше сначала изучить одно, а потом другое?
источник

ЕП

Евгений Петров... in aiogram [ru]
Vela
Даже заказ
Всегда поражаюсь такому
источник

DB

Dima Boger in aiogram [ru]
я б сначала сделал, потом бы уже с докером игрался

благо вещи разделяемые
источник